我正在尝试在Google电子表格中使用ImportXML并获得NA结果。错误讯息:
导入XML内容无法解析
网址:http://www.tripadvisor.com/Hotel_Review-g293916-d309884-Reviews-Indra_Regent_Hotel-Bangkok.html
这就是我所拥有的:
importxml(url, "//img[@class='sprite-rating_rr_fill rating_rr_fill rr35']/@content")
这就是我想要抓住的: the content attribute value of img
我期待着你的建议。我不确定我做错了什么。
答案 0 :(得分:0)
这不是你的xpath是错误的,而是不是正确的xml文档的源(img标签没有关闭)。
的确,如果您尝试运行:
=IMPORTXML( url, "//div[@class='rs rating']" )
它解析为:
1,087 Reviews.
但是它的任何后代都会抛出错误。 你可以尝试首先通过“消毒剂”传递html源,然后它应该可以工作。